  "details": "In the Linux kernel, the following vulnerability has been resolved:  openvswitch: only skb_tx_error() a packet we are about to drop  queue_userspace_packet() borrows the packet skb -- it only copies it into a private netlink message (user_skb) and does not own it; on return do_execute_actions() keeps forwarding it through the flow's remaining actions. Its error path nevertheless calls skb_tx_error(skb), which via skb_zcopy_clear() does skb_shinfo(skb)-\u003eflags \u0026= ~SKBFL_ALL_ZEROCOPY, stripping SKBFL_SHARED_FRAG from that live skb (skb_tx_error()'s kerneldoc says \"skb must be freed afterwards\").  For a MSG_ZEROCOPY skb carrying page-cache frags, SKBFL_SHARED_FRAG is what makes esp_input() skb_cow_data() before in-place AEAD; once it is stripped a later local ESP-in-UDP delivery decrypts in place over pages the sender does not own -- an unprivileged page-cache write (the \"Fragnesia\" primitive). do_execute_actions() ignores output_userspace()'s return value, so any action after a failed USERSPACE upcall inherits the stripped skb.  Move the skb_tx_error() to the flow-miss drop path - the \"default\" branch of ovs_dp_process_packet()'s switch(error), before kfree_skb().  The call has been here since commit 36d5fe6a0007 (\"core, nfqueue, openvswitch: Orphan frags in skb_zerocopy and handle errors\") but was harmless until esp_input() began relying on SKBFL_SHARED_FRAG to gate in-place decrypt; only then did stripping it on a still-forwarded skb become a page-cache write primitive.",
